I want to buy some shadow raps, would you throw them on your regular cranking rod, like a MH 7'?

 

That's what I plan on doing. I would recommend using a rod that has a good parabolic bend. Early this year I did get snagged up and found that the Shadow Rap's hooks can bend fairly easy... so just be aware of that and you should be fine.
